Latvian Potato Pancakes

Latvian Potato Pancakes

Crispy golden Latvian potato pancakes with a soft potato center, served hot with sour cream.

Time30 min
Servings4
Calories362 kcal
LevelEasy

Ingredients

  • potato600 g
  • egg1 pcs
  • wheat flour60 g
  • vegetable oil3 tbsp
  • salt1 to taste
  • black pepper (ground)1 to taste
  • sour cream for serving150 g

Instructions

1

Peel the potatoes, rinse them, and grate finely into a large bowl.

2

Transfer the grated potatoes to a sieve or a clean kitchen towel and squeeze out the excess liquid well so the mixture isn't watery.

3

Add the egg, flour, salt, and black pepper, and mix thoroughly until you get a smooth, thick batter.

4

Heat oil in a large skillet over medium heat; the bottom should be thinly and evenly coated with oil.

5

Spoon 1 heaping tablespoon of the potato mixture per pancake onto the skillet, flatten to about 5 mm thick, and fry in batches without overcrowding the pan.

6

Fry the pancakes for 3–4 minutes on each side, flipping once, until golden and crispy.

7

Transfer the finished pancakes to a paper towel to drain excess oil, and keep warm until you finish frying the rest.

8

Serve immediately, hot, with sour cream.
